It is comprised of many bones, which are formed … golf gti 5 computer diplaySpletSuture (anatomy) In anatomy, a suture is a fairly rigid joint between two or more hard elements of an organism, with or without significant overlap of the elements. Sutures are found in the skeletons or exoskeletons of a wide range of animals, in both invertebrates and vertebrates. The brain … golf gti all wheel driveSpletA suture is a type of fibrous joint that is only found in the skull (cranial suture).The bones are bound together by Sharpey's fibres.A tiny amount of movement is permitted at sutures, which contributes to the compliance and elasticity of the skull. These joints are synarthroses.
